Referring now to the drawings and the detailed description, as shown in fig. 1-3, an environmental protection dust removal blanking device for pipe according to an embodiment of the present invention comprises a support frame 1 and a blanking scoop 2, wherein a cutting box 4 is welded on the top surface of the support frame 1, a placing box 5 is welded on one side of the cutting box 4, a pneumatic vacuum cleaner 6 is movably placed in the placing box 5, a vacuum port of the pneumatic vacuum cleaner 6 is communicated with a vacuum pipe 7, one end of the vacuum pipe 7 is fixed with a vacuum hood 8, the vacuum hood 8 is communicated with the cutting box 4, a side opening 15 is opened on the side surface of the cutting box 4, a blanking port 9 is opened on the front end surface of the cutting box 4, a through port is opened on the inner side of the support frame 1, a cutting wheel 10 is rotatably connected to the inner side of the through port through a central shaft and a bearing seat, the upper portion of the cutting wheel 10 extends to the inner side of the cutting box 4, the bottom of the support frame 1 is welded with a mounting frame 13, a motor 14 is fixed in the mounting frame 13 through bolts, a belt is wound between an output shaft of the motor 14 and a central shaft of the cutting wheel 10, a blanking inclined hopper 2 is welded on the side surface of the support frame 1, a guide plate 12 is welded on the inner side of the blanking inclined hopper 2, an inserting plate 11 is inserted into one side of the guide plate 12, a plastic pipe is conveyed onto the support frame 1 to be driven to enter the cutting box 4 through an opening 15, then the plastic pipe is manually moved to be close to the cutting wheel 10, the output shaft of the motor 14 is driven to drive the cutting wheel 10 to transmit under the action of the belt through starting the motor 14, so that the cutting of the plastic pipe is realized, in the process, a pneumatic dust collector 6 in the mounting box 5 is started to drive a dust collection pipe 7 and a dust collection cover 8 to serve as a dust collection pipe 7 path, and scraps and dust generated in the cutting process of the cutting box 4 are absorbed, the scattering of chips and dust pollution are avoided, the environment friendliness is strong, when the plastic pipe is fed, the plastic pipe is pushed out from the feeding opening 9 of the cutting box 4, the plastic pipe is made to slide to the inserting plate 11 in an inclined manner under the action of the guide plate 12, the rubber pads 16 bonded on the inner side wall of the feeding inclined bucket 2 and the surface of the inserting plate 11 can increase the elasticity of contact with the pipe, and the safety of pipe feeding is guaranteed;
in one embodiment, a rubber pad 16 is bonded on the inner side wall of the blanking inclined bucket 2 and the surface of the insertion plate 11, the guide plate 12 is welded on the inner side surface of the blanking inclined bucket 2 in an inclined mode, and the rubber pad 16 can increase the contact elasticity of the blanking inclined bucket 2 and the insertion plate 11 and a plastic pipe.
In one embodiment, limiting plates 3 are welded at the edges of the top surface of the support frame 1, round rod-shaped supporting legs are welded at four corners of the bottom surface of the support frame 1, the limiting plates 3 can limit the edges of the support frame 1, and pipes are prevented from falling.
In one embodiment, the cross section of the mounting frame 13 is a U-shaped structure, and the side surface of the mounting frame 13 is welded to the blanking inclined hopper 2 through a cross rod, so that the firmness of the blanking inclined hopper 2 can be increased through the cross rod.
In one embodiment, a control panel is fixedly mounted on the outer wall surface of the placement box 5, the output end of the control panel is electrically connected with the motor 14 and the pneumatic dust collector respectively, and a control circuit of the control panel can be realized through simple programming by a person skilled in the art, and the control panel belongs to the common knowledge in the field, is only used without being modified, so that the detailed description of a control mode and circuit connection is omitted, wherein the control panel is connected with an external power supply through a wire, and the power supply is convenient.
In one embodiment, the section of the discharging inclined hopper 2 is of a U-shaped structure, a slot is formed in the inner side surface of the discharging inclined hopper 2 corresponding to the inserting plate 11, the inserting and fixing of the inserting plate 11 are facilitated through the slot, the falling pipe is blocked protectively, and the falling pipe is picked up conveniently.
In one embodiment, the top surface of the cutting box 4 is opened with a dust suction opening corresponding to the dust suction hood 8, and the dust suction opening is used for sucking the cutting dust and debris in the cutting box 4.
